In a recent video by Google's Matt Cutts, he said that geo-location
is not spam. Cloaking and showing GoogleBot content that you wouldn't
show users, is spam. But showing geo-location based content to users,
while showing that content to GoogleBot, is not spam.

In
short, if you are going to geo your content, make sure to serve
GoogleBot the content you would serve any user who is based in the
United States. Serve GoogleBot based on the location of the IP address
it is coming from.
